:root{--bg-primary: #0b0d12;--bg-secondary: #101521;--bg-tertiary: #151c2c;--text-primary: #edf2ff;--text-secondary: rgba(237, 242, 255, .72);--text-dim: rgba(237, 242, 255, .52);--neon-green: #2dd4bf;--neon-green-glow: rgba(45, 212, 191, .28);--neon-blue: #60a5fa;--warning: #f59e0b;--danger: #ef4444;--error: var(--danger);--success: var(--neon-green);--border-subtle: rgba(237, 242, 255, .1);--border-active: rgba(237, 242, 255, .18);--font-mono: "DM Mono", monospace;--font-sans: "Space Grotesk", sans-serif;--spacing-unit: 4px;--shadow-soft: 0 24px 70px rgba(0, 0, 0, .55)}*{box-sizing:border-box}body{margin:0;font-family:var(--font-sans);background:radial-gradient(1200px 600px at 15% -10%,rgba(45,212,191,.16),transparent 60%),radial-gradient(900px 540px at 110% 15%,rgba(96,165,250,.14),transparent 55%),radial-gradient(740px 480px at 30% 115%,rgba(245,158,11,.1),transparent 55%),var(--bg-primary);color:var(--text-primary);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}h1,h2,h3,h4,h5,h6{font-family:var(--font-sans);font-weight:600;letter-spacing:-.01em;margin:0}button{font-family:var(--font-sans);border:none;background:none;cursor:pointer;color:inherit}input,textarea{font-family:var(--font-sans);background:var(--bg-secondary);border:1px solid var(--border-subtle);color:var(--text-primary);outline:none}input::placeholder,textarea::placeholder{color:var(--text-dim)}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:var(--bg-primary)}::-webkit-scrollbar-thumb{background:var(--border-active);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:var(--text-secondary)}input[type=range]{-webkit-appearance:none;width:100%;background:transparent}input[type=range]:focus{outline:none}input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;height:16px;width:16px;border-radius:50%;background:var(--neon-green);cursor:pointer;margin-top:-7px;box-shadow:0 0 10px var(--neon-green)}input[type=range]::-webkit-slider-runnable-track{width:100%;height:2px;cursor:pointer;background:var(--border-active);border-radius:1px}.shell{min-height:100vh;display:grid;grid-template-columns:280px minmax(0,1fr);position:relative;isolation:isolate}.shell:before{content:"";position:fixed;inset:-18px;background-image:var(--user-bg-image, none);background-size:cover;background-position:center;background-repeat:no-repeat;opacity:var(--user-bg-opacity, 0);filter:blur(var(--user-bg-blur, 18px)) saturate(1.06);transform:scale(1.06);z-index:-2;pointer-events:none}.shell:after{content:"";position:fixed;inset:0;opacity:var(--user-bg-opacity, 0);background:rgba(11,13,18,var(--user-bg-dim, .68));z-index:-1;pointer-events:none}.shell__sidebar{padding:22px 18px;border-right:1px solid var(--border-subtle);background:linear-gradient(180deg,#ffffff0a,#ffffff05);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);position:sticky;top:0;align-self:start;height:100vh;display:flex;flex-direction:column;gap:18px;overflow-y:auto}.shell__brand{display:flex;align-items:center;gap:10px}.shell__brandMark{width:36px;height:36px;border-radius:12px;background:#2dd4bf26;border:1px solid rgba(45,212,191,.35);display:grid;place-items:center;color:var(--neon-green)}.shell__brandTitle{display:grid;gap:2px}.shell__brandTitle strong{letter-spacing:.16em;text-transform:uppercase;font-size:12px;font-weight:600}.shell__brandTitle span{font-size:11px;color:var(--text-dim)}.shell__nav{display:grid;gap:8px}.shell__navButton{text-align:left;border:1px solid transparent;padding:10px 12px;border-radius:14px;background:transparent;display:grid;gap:4px}.shell__navButton:hover{border-color:#edf2ff1f;background:#ffffff08}.shell__navButton[data-active=true]{border-color:#2dd4bf66;background:#2dd4bf1a}.shell__navRow{display:flex;align-items:center;gap:10px}.shell__navLabel{font-size:13px;font-weight:600;color:var(--text-primary)}.shell__navDesc{font-size:11px;color:var(--text-secondary);line-height:1.2;margin-left:30px}.shell__sidebarFooter{display:grid;gap:10px;margin-top:auto}.shell__pill{border:1px solid rgba(237,242,255,.12);background:#ffffff08;border-radius:999px;padding:8px 12px;font-size:11px;color:var(--text-secondary);display:flex;justify-content:space-between;gap:10px}.shell__content{padding:28px 26px 70px}.page{max-width:1120px;margin:0 auto}.page--wide{max-width:1440px}.page__header{display:grid;gap:8px;margin-bottom:18px}.page__header h1{font-family:var(--font-sans);letter-spacing:-.02em;font-weight:600;font-size:28px}.page__header p{margin:0;color:var(--text-secondary);max-width:70ch;line-height:1.4}.card{border:1px solid var(--border-subtle);background:#101521b8;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:18px;padding:18px;box-shadow:var(--shadow-soft)}.card__title{font-size:11px;letter-spacing:.16em;text-transform:uppercase;color:var(--text-dim);margin-bottom:10px}.grid2{display:grid;grid-template-columns:minmax(0,1.1fr) minmax(320px,.9fr);gap:16px}.details{border:1px solid var(--border-subtle);border-radius:16px;background:#ffffff05;overflow:hidden}.details>summary{cursor:pointer;list-style:none;padding:12px 14px;display:flex;align-items:center;justify-content:space-between;gap:12px;font-weight:600;color:var(--text-primary)}.details>summary::-webkit-details-marker{display:none}.details__body{padding:14px;border-top:1px solid var(--border-subtle)}.btn{height:38px;padding:0 14px;border-radius:14px;border:1px solid var(--border-subtle);background:#ffffff05;color:var(--text-secondary);font-weight:600;font-size:13px;display:inline-flex;align-items:center;justify-content:center;gap:8px;transition:background .14s ease,border-color .14s ease,transform .14s ease,opacity .14s ease}.btn:hover{background:#ffffff0a;border-color:#edf2ff2e}.btn:active{transform:translateY(1px)}.btn[disabled]{opacity:.55;cursor:not-allowed}.btn--primary{background:var(--neon-green);border-color:#2dd4bfa6;color:#041211}.btn--primary:hover{background:#44e4d0}.btn--outline{border-color:#2dd4bf8c;background:#2dd4bf1a;color:var(--text-primary)}.btn--ghost{background:transparent}.btn--danger{border-color:#ef444473;background:#ef444414;color:#ffa1a1f2}.btn--sm{height:32px;padding:0 12px;border-radius:12px;font-size:12px;gap:6px}.field{display:grid;gap:6px}.field label{font-size:12px;color:var(--text-secondary);font-weight:600}.hint{font-size:12px;color:var(--text-dim);line-height:1.35}.control{width:100%;min-height:38px;border-radius:14px;border:1px solid var(--border-subtle);background:#151c2cd9;padding:0 12px;color:var(--text-primary);font-size:13px}.control:focus{border-color:#2dd4bf80;box-shadow:0 0 0 3px #2dd4bf1f}.control--textarea{padding:12px;min-height:140px;resize:vertical;line-height:1.5}.pillRow{display:flex;gap:10px;flex-wrap:wrap;align-items:center}.pill{border:1px solid rgba(237,242,255,.12);background:#ffffff05;padding:6px 10px;border-radius:999px;font-size:12px;color:var(--text-secondary)}.pill strong{color:var(--text-primary);font-weight:600}.splitHeader{display:flex;align-items:baseline;justify-content:space-between;gap:12px;flex-wrap:wrap}@keyframes spin{to{transform:rotate(360deg)}}.spin{animation:spin .9s linear infinite}.assetStudioLayout{display:grid;grid-template-columns:minmax(280px,340px) minmax(0,1fr);gap:18px;align-items:start}.assetStudioLayout--focus{grid-template-columns:minmax(0,1fr)}.assetStudioSidebar,.assetStudioJobs{position:sticky;top:22px;align-self:start;max-height:calc(100vh - 44px);overflow:auto;padding-right:4px}.assetStudioMain{min-width:0}.assetStudioCard{border:1px solid var(--border-subtle);background:#101521a8;border-radius:18px;overflow:hidden;display:grid;grid-template-rows:auto auto 1fr;box-shadow:0 28px 70px #00000047}.assetStudioCard__top{padding:12px 12px 0}.assetStudioCard__media{margin-top:10px;background:#00000038;border-top:1px solid rgba(237,242,255,.06);border-bottom:1px solid rgba(237,242,255,.06);aspect-ratio:4 / 5;overflow:hidden}.assetStudioCard__media img{width:100%;height:100%;display:block;object-fit:cover;transform:scale(1.01)}.assetStudioCard__body{padding:12px;display:grid;gap:10px}.assetStudioStickyBar{position:sticky;top:0;z-index:6;margin-top:10px;margin-bottom:12px;padding:10px 12px;border-radius:16px;border:1px solid rgba(237,242,255,.12);background:#0b0d12b8;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);display:flex;align-items:center;justify-content:space-between;gap:10px;flex-wrap:wrap}.assetStudioDock{position:fixed;right:18px;bottom:18px;z-index:50;display:grid;gap:10px}.assetStudioOverlay{position:fixed;inset:0;background:#000000b8;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);z-index:1000;display:grid;place-items:center;padding:18px}.assetStudioOverlay__card{width:min(980px,100%);max-height:92vh;overflow:auto;box-shadow:none}@media(max-width:980px){.shell{grid-template-columns:1fr}.shell__sidebar{position:relative;height:auto;border-right:none;border-bottom:1px solid var(--border-subtle);overflow:visible}.shell__sidebarFooter{margin-top:14px}.shell__navDesc{display:none}.grid2,.assetStudioLayout{grid-template-columns:1fr}.assetStudioSidebar,.assetStudioJobs{position:relative;top:auto;max-height:none;overflow:visible;padding-right:0}.assetStudioDock{right:14px;bottom:14px}}
